Kaydon Bearings Celebrates 25 Years in Mexic

The Kaydon Bearings division operations in Monterrey, Mexico, celebrated its 25th anniversary in April. During the time the plant has grown from 12 employees to nearly 500 and has produced roughly 490,000 slewing ring bearings for customers around the world. United Rentals Completes RSC Acquisition

United Rentals Inc. has officially acquired RSC Holdings Inc. in a cash-and-stock transaction valued at $18.00 per share at the time of announcement, for a total enterprise value of $4.2 billion, including $2.3 billion of net debt. HAWE Adds CAN-IO14 Control Unit to Mobile Equipment Lineup

HAWE Hydraulics, Charlotte, N.C., has released of the CAN-IO14 control unit. The unit has four proportional outputs and four pulse-width modulation (PWM) outputs, all of which can also be configured as inputs.
